Off The Shelf: Eco-friendly paper wine bottle is a U.S. first
California winery Truett-Hurst introduces a wine bottle made from a molded-pulp outer shell, with an inner film liner. The PaperBoy bottle is fully recyclable and has been designed to appeal to eco-friendly consumers looking for a lightweight, portable option to glass wine bottles.

Off The Shelf: Plantable, compostable pod holds produce seeds
Scotts Miracle-Gro introduces the Gro-Ables Seed Pod, which offers consumers a foolproof way to grow their own herbs and produce from seeds. Seeds, along with fertilizer, are contained in a ‘pod’ made from compostable materials that can be planted directly in the ground and turns to compost by the following growing season.

Off the Shelf: Thelma’s Treats uses ‘Oven box’ for cookie deliveries
The carton is not only printed with graphics to resemble a 1950s-style oven, it also include front carton flaps that open like an oven door to allow consumers to open it and retrieve the just-baked hot cookies.

Off The Shelf: New guacamole packs make serving and snacking a cinch
Wholly Guacamole introduces a peel-and-serve tray in 8- and 16-oz sizes, and a 100-calorie cup for single-serve, on-the-go snacking of its all-natural guacamole dips.
